Embodiment 1

[0021] When a gas well in a gas field is opened, when the pressure recovery is high, it is necessary to manually operate the needle valve gently to throttle and reduce the pressure during the well opening, so as to prevent the pressure of the pipeline downstream of the needle valve from exceeding the design 6.3MPa pressure, because the throttling process is inevitable When the temperature drops, a certain amount of hydrate will gradually be formed in the wellhead pipeline downstream of the needle valve, and due to the throttling and cooling phenomenon of the needle valve at the wellhead during the well opening process, some hydrate particles formed during the well opening will go down with the air flow and block the wellhead surface The swirling vortex flowmeter downstream of the pipeline caused ice blockage in the pipeline. Embodiment 3

[0031] On the basis of Example 2, such as figure 2 As shown, the ribbon-type vortex generator 3 is a wavy ribbon-shaped structure, and the wavy ribbon-shaped structure has a plurality of vortex waveform periods, and the waveform of each vortex waveform period is twisted. The included angle between the tangent line of the outer edge of the tie of the tie-type vortex generator 3 and the central axis of the oil pipe 2 is 50 degrees. The bond type vortex generator 3 has two vortex waveform periods.

[0032] The bond-type vortex generator 3 can induce the airflow in the pipeline to generate a relatively regular vortex flow pattern, and use the sweeping characteristics of the vortex to enhance the liquid-carrying of the airflow, reduce the liquid phase adhesion on the pipe wall, and alleviate the formation of hydrate particles. Abstract

The invention provides a tie-type gas well opening and slow plugging device and an application method thereof. The tie-type gas well opening and slow-plugging device includes an oil pipe, a plurality of tie-type vortex generators are installed in the inner cavity of the oil pipe, and a plurality of tie-type vortex generators It is fixed on the inner wall of the oil pipe in a straight line along the axial direction of the oil pipe, and the two ends of the oil pipe are respectively connected to the first flange and the second flange. The inner cavity of the oil pipe is also provided with a hydrate filter plate, which is placed in the inner cavity of the downstream of the oil pipe perpendicular to the central axis of the oil pipe, and is located downstream of the bonded vortex generator. The tie-type gas well opening slow plugging device and its application method can alleviate and prevent the flow path of the flow meter downstream of the gas well wellhead pipeline due to hydrate particles during the well opening process through the vortex generator at the front end of the tubing and the hydrate filter plate at the rear end. It can improve the success rate of gas well start-up, reduce the difficulty of gas well management and maintenance, save manpower and material resources, and has broad application prospects in the field of gas field exploitation.
